Avionics Technicians

 

Job Locations:

�       Cheyenne, Wyoming

�       Denver, Colorado

�       Huron, South Dakota

�       Grand Island, Nebraska

 

Job Summary:

�       Troubleshoot and repair Collins Pro Line II avionics to box level.

�       Troubleshoot and repair GMB120 and B1900 C&D wiring to component level.

�       Bench Technicians, troubleshoot and repair to component level Collins Pro Line II radio equipment, Beech PCB�s, and King equipment

 

Requirements:

�       Applicant must be able to use wiring diagrams and aircraft manuals in implementation of repairs.

�       A&P license or equivalent avionics experience.

�       FCC license a plus for line maintenance and is a requirement for bench technicians

A&P Mechanics

 

Job Locations:

�       Cheyenne, Wyoming

�       Denver, Colorado

�       Grand Island, Nebraska

�       Huron, South Dakota

 

Job Summary:

�       Inspect, repair, service and troubleshoot Beechcraft 1900 and Embraer 120 Aircraft

 

Requirements:

�       A&P License

�       Great troubleshooting skills.

�       Applicant must be able to work as a team member or on an individual level as required

�       Applicant must be able to read and understand wiring schematics and technical manuals

Crew Planning

 

Job Location:

�       Cheyenne, Wyoming

 

Job Summary:

�       Responsible for all crewmember scheduling

�       Create and maintain monthly crewmember schedules

�       Assign reserve crewmembers as required

�       Coordinate with the Director of Training to ensure that all crewmembers are scheduled for required training

�       Ensure that all crewmembers schedules are maintained with the FAA requirements and company policy

�       Assist the flight department in establishing crewmember staffing

�       Ensure compliance with applicable shift checklists

 

Requirements:

�       Must be detail oriented and able to work well under pressure

�       Must be able to provide excellent customer service skills

Flight Attendants

 

Location:

�       All Flight Attendants are based out of Cheyenne, Wyoming

 

Job Summary:

�       Responsible for the comfort, safety and handling of the passengers in compliance with the FAR�s and Inflight Services Manual

�       Shall report during flight to the Pilot-in-Command, and at other times to the Chief Flight Attendant

�       Responsible to maintain current knowledge of all inflight and emergency procedures

�       Responsible for preflight inspection in relation to cabin duties

�       Responsible for cabin cleanliness and sanitary conditions of commissary and associated serving equipment

�       Responsible for inflight service, as prescribed in company policies and procedures

�       Responsible for promoting passenger satisfaction in a professional manner

�       Assist the flight crew and/or customer service representative, as needed, to ensure prompt departures

�       Other duties, as assigned, by the Chief Flight Attendant

 

Requirements:

�       Ability to work under pressure and handle multiple tasks

�       Effective communication skills
